How to do SEO for a website step by step

In the intricate realm of Search Engine Optimization (SEO), understanding your audience is the cornerstone of success. To truly master the art of how to do SEO for a website step by step, one must embark on a journey into the depths of their target demographic. Conducting comprehensive research to unravel the intricacies of demographic details, preferences, and online behaviors becomes not just a recommendation but a necessity. This insightful knowledge forms the bedrock upon which a successful SEO strategy is constructed.

How can one effectively integrate their keyword into content if they lack an intimate understanding of the language and search patterns their audience employs? It’s this profound understanding that allows for the seamless integration of your keyword, strategically placed to resonate with the interests and needs of your audience. Recognizing and addressing your audience’s preferences not only serves as a recipe for improved SEO but also ensures that your website becomes a magnet for the right kind of traffic.

Delving into the psyche of your audience involves more than just demographic data. It requires an exploration of their pain points, desires, and the questions they seek answers to. By aligning your content with these aspects, you not only enhance your SEO strategy but also establish a deeper connection with your audience.

Moreover, understanding the intent behind the searches your audience conducts is pivotal. Whether they are seeking information, looking to make a purchase, or just browsing for entertainment, tailoring your content to align with these intentions ensures that your website addresses their needs effectively. This targeted approach not only improves your SEO but also elevates the overall user experience, fostering long-term relationships with your audience.

As you weave your keyword seamlessly into this understanding of your audience, the alignment becomes more than just strategic—it becomes an organic part of the user experience. The keyword integration resonates with the language your audience uses, creating a website that not only ranks well but also speaks directly to the hearts and minds of your visitors.

The integration of your keyword is not a mere repetition but a strategic infusion that enhances the relevance of your content to your audience. This isn’t just about search engine algorithms; it’s about creating a website that genuinely serves the needs of those who visit it. Therefore, the keyword becomes not just a tool for SEO but a linguistic bridge that connects your content with the thoughts and queries of your audience.


In the vast landscape of SEO, one phrase stands out—Content is king. The significance of creating compelling, relevant, and high-quality content is not just a best practice but the nucleus of effective optimization. When contemplating how to do SEO for a website step by step, prioritizing the development of content that not only captures but retains the attention of your audience becomes paramount. This isn’t merely about churning out words; it’s about crafting a narrative that resonates with the needs and interests of your audience.

Regularly updating your website with fresh, informative material is not just a tactic but a commitment to remaining a relevant source in your industry. This commitment not only keeps visitors engaged but also positions your website as a reliable and up-to-date resource. The strategic infusion of your keyword into this content isn’t a forced inclusion; it’s a seamless integration that reinforces the relevance of your website to both users and search engines.

Moreover, the depth and breadth of your content contribute significantly to your website’s authority within your niche. In-depth articles, comprehensive guides, and multimedia elements not only cater to different learning styles but also signal to search engines that your website is a comprehensive source of information. This comprehensive approach, coupled with the strategic inclusion of your keyword, positions your content as both informative and relevant, catering to the diverse needs of your audience.

It’s not just about incorporating your keyword into the text; it’s about creating content that naturally revolves around it. When users encounter your content, they should not feel like they stumbled upon a keyword-stuffed article but rather an engaging and informative piece that aligns seamlessly with their search intent. The keyword, in this context, becomes the thread that weaves through the fabric of your content, enhancing its visibility and relevance.

Striking a balance between optimizing for search engines and creating content for human consumption is an art. Your content should not only be search engine-friendly but also user-friendly. It’s not just about meeting the criteria of algorithms; it’s about creating an experience that captivates and educates your audience. The keyword, when strategically placed, becomes a catalyst for this harmonious blend of SEO and user experience.

Titles and tags matter:

In the symphony of SEO, crafting attention-grabbing titles and utilizing relevant tags is akin to composing the perfect overture. As you navigate the intricacies of how to do SEO for a website step by step, meticulous attention must be paid to optimizing title tags and meta descriptions with your keyword. These elements serve as the initial point of contact between your content and potential users on search engine result pages. By strategically incorporating your keyword into these crucial elements, you not only enhance your website’s visibility but also increase the likelihood of users clicking on your link.

Titles are not just headlines; they are invitations. An engaging title not only captures attention but also sets the tone for what users can expect from your content. When your keyword is seamlessly integrated into the title, it not only improves search engine recognition but also aligns with the language your audience uses when conducting searches.

Meta descriptions, though concise, are powerful snippets that can entice users to click. Crafting meta descriptions that not only provide a brief overview of your content but also incorporate your keyword reinforces the relevance of your content to both users and search engines. It’s not about stuffing these elements with keywords; it’s about creating a compelling narrative that encourages users to delve deeper into your website.

Consistency is the linchpin in this endeavor. Weaving your keyword into titles and tags reinforces its relevance, creating a harmonious association with your content in the eyes of both search engines and users. This consistency goes beyond a mere repetition of words; it’s about creating a cohesive narrative that resonates with your audience throughout their journey on your website.

Moreover, the strategic inclusion of your keyword in titles and tags enhances the overall structure of your website. Search engines, guided by these elements, gain a clearer understanding of the content hierarchy and its relevance. This enhanced understanding contributes to improved rankings and visibility in search engine results.

Titles and tags are not just technical aspects of SEO; they are the ambassadors of your content. When users encounter these elements, they should not feel like they stumbled upon a generic website but rather a destination that speaks directly to their queries. The keyword, when thoughtfully integrated, becomes the beacon that guides users to content tailored to their needs.

Structure is key:

The architecture of your website is not just the scaffolding that holds it together; it’s the blueprint for SEO success. A well-organized and logically structured layout doesn’t just enhance user experience; it significantly contributes to improved search engine rankings. When meticulously planning how to do SEO for a website step by step, focus on creating a site structure that is intuitive and easy to navigate. Strategic integration of your keyword into headings and subheadings aids search engines in comprehending the hierarchical structure of your content.

The structure of your website is the roadmap users follow to explore your content. When this roadmap is clear and well-defined, users can easily navigate through different sections, finding the information they seek effortlessly. The strategic placement of your keyword in these navigational elements isn’t just for search engines; it’s a signpost for users, guiding them to relevant sections and establishing a seamless browsing experience.

Headings and subheadings not only break down your content into digestible sections but also provide search engines with valuable insights into the topics covered. The strategic inclusion of your keyword in these elements reinforces the thematic relevance of your content. It’s not just about making your content readable; it’s about signaling to search engines that your website covers a spectrum of information related to your keyword.

Moreover, a well-structured website contributes to lower bounce rates and increased time spent on your pages. When users find it easy to navigate and access the information they need, they are more likely to explore further. This user engagement sends positive signals to search engines, indicating that your website is not just accessible but also valuable to visitors.

Consistency in the strategic integration of your keyword into the structure of your website enhances its association with different sections. It’s not about creating separate silos of content; it’s about interconnecting topics and providing a comprehensive resource for users. This interconnectedness, coupled with the strategic placement of your keyword, elevates your website’s visibility in search engine results.

Furthermore, a well-structured website is not just about headings and subheadings; it extends to the overall organization of your content. Logical categorization, clear navigation menus, and a user-friendly interface contribute to a positive user experience. The keyword, when seamlessly integrated into this structure, becomes more than just a component of SEO; it becomes a guiding thread that weaves through the tapestry of your website.

Be mobile-friendly:

In the contemporary digital landscape, being mobile-friendly isn’t just a trend; it’s a necessity for SEO success. As an increasing number of users gravitate towards accessing websites through mobile devices, search engines prioritize mobile-friendly sites in their rankings. When unraveling the intricacies of how to do SEO for a website step by step, optimizing your website for various screen sizes is not an option but a necessity.

Mobile-friendliness goes beyond just responsive design; it’s about creating an experience tailored to the preferences of mobile users. The strategic inclusion of your keyword into mobile-optimized content ensures that your website maintains a consistent signal of its relevance, regardless of the platform through which users access it. It’s not just about resizing elements for smaller screens; it’s about crafting a seamless and user-friendly experience that aligns with the expectations of mobile users.

The integration of your keyword into mobile content extends to various elements, including images, buttons, and navigation menus. These elements should not just be functional; they should contribute to a positive and intuitive mobile experience. When users encounter your website on their mobile devices, they should not feel like they are navigating a scaled-down version but rather a platform that prioritizes their needs.

Moreover, the loading speed of your mobile pages plays a pivotal role in user satisfaction and SEO rankings. As mobile users often seek quick answers on the go, a fast-loading website becomes imperative. The strategic incorporation of your keyword into mobile-optimized content, coupled with efficient page load times, enhances the overall mobile experience.

Consistency in the mobile-friendliness of your website, combined with the strategic integration of your keyword, positions your content as accessible and relevant across different devices. It’s not just about catering to a segment of your audience; it’s about providing a consistent and high-quality experience to users, regardless of their preferred device.

The keyword, when seamlessly integrated into the mobile optimization process, becomes more than just a tag; it becomes a symbol of your commitment to user-centric design. It’s a testament to your acknowledgment of the diverse ways in which users access your content. Therefore, the mobile-friendliness of your website, coupled with the strategic inclusion of your keyword, becomes a holistic approach to SEO that resonates with the preferences of your audience.

Speed is essential:

In the fast-paced digital realm, speed isn’t just a luxury; it’s a critical factor influencing both user experience and SEO rankings. The speed at which your website pages load directly influences bounce rates and overall user satisfaction. When formulating a strategy for how to do SEO for a website step by step, prioritizing the optimization of your website’s speed should be at the forefront.

Speed is not just about efficiency; it’s about creating an experience that aligns with the expectations of today’s internet users. The strategic incorporation of your keyword into a fast-loading website isn’t just a technical optimization; it’s a commitment to delivering timely and efficient results to users. It’s about ensuring that users find what they seek without unnecessary delays.

Compressing images, implementing browser caching, and minimizing unnecessary code are not just technical tasks; they are steps towards creating a website that responds swiftly to user queries. The keyword, strategically placed within the framework of a fast-loading website, becomes more than just a tag; it becomes a symbol of your dedication to user-centric design.

Moreover, the loading speed of your website isn’t just a technical consideration; it’s a ranking factor in search engine algorithms. Search engines recognize the importance of delivering results promptly to users, and fast-loading sites are prioritized accordingly. The strategic inclusion of your keyword into a website optimized for speed enhances its association with a positive user experience and contributes significantly to improved search engine rankings.

Consistency in the optimization of your website’s speed, coupled with the strategic integration of your keyword, positions your website as not just accessible but also responsive to the needs of your audience. It’s not just about meeting technical benchmarks; it’s about creating a browsing experience that aligns with the fast-paced nature of today’s online landscape.

Furthermore, the strategic placement of your keyword within a fast-loading website extends to various elements, including headlines, images, and calls to action. These elements should not just be visually appealing; they should contribute to a seamless and efficient user journey. When users encounter a website that loads swiftly and provides the information they seek without delays, it’s not just a positive user experience; it’s a reflection of your commitment to excellence in the digital realm.

The keyword, when thoughtfully integrated into a fast-loading website, becomes more than just a component of SEO; it becomes a catalyst for a positive and efficient user experience. It becomes a symbol of your dedication to creating a website that not only ranks well in search engines but also resonates with the preferences of your audience in the ever-evolving digital landscape.

Earn some links:

Building a robust network of backlinks is not just a strategy; it’s a fundamental pillar of off-page SEO. Earning high-quality and relevant links from reputable websites within your industry is not just a tactic; it’s a testament to the credibility and value of your content. As you navigate the intricacies of how to do SEO for a website step by step, cultivating genuine relationships that result in valuable backlinks becomes a priority.

    The strategic inclusion of your keyword in anchor text within these backlinks is not just a technicality; it’s a reinforcement of the thematic relevance of your content. When external sources link to your website using your keyword as anchor text, it becomes more than just a tag; it becomes a signal to search engines that your content is authoritative and valuable within your niche.

    Moreover, the quality of backlinks matters more than the quantity. A handful of high-quality backlinks from reputable sources can have a more significant impact than numerous links from low-authority websites. The strategic integration of your keyword into anchor text within these high-quality backlinks elevates the overall perception of your content in the eyes of search engines.

    Building relationships within your industry and earning backlinks is not just a task to check off; it’s an ongoing effort to establish your website as a reputable source of information. The keyword, strategically infused into these relationships, becomes more than just a component of SEO; it becomes a bridge that connects your content with the broader landscape of your industry.

    Furthermore, the anchor text is not just a link; it’s a contextual reference to the content it leads to. The strategic inclusion of your keyword in anchor text reinforces the connection between the linked content and the overarching theme of your website. It’s not just about acquiring links; it’s about creating a network of references that enhances the visibility and authority of your content.

    Consistency in the strategic integration of your keyword into anchor text within high-quality backlinks positions your content as not just informative but also influential within your industry. It’s not just about earning links; it’s about earning references that contribute to the overall narrative of your content. The keyword, when thoughtfully placed in these references, becomes more than just a tag; it becomes a symbol of your website’s authority and relevance in the digital landscape.

    Moreover, the outreach efforts to earn backlinks are not just about transactional relationships; they are about fostering genuine connections within your industry. The keyword, strategically woven into these relationships, becomes more than just a part of your SEO strategy; it becomes a language that resonates with those who recognize the value and credibility of your content.

    Track your progress:

    In the dynamic world of SEO, adaptation and evolution are the keys to sustained success. Tracking your progress is not just a perfunctory final step; it’s an ongoing practice that guides the continuous refinement of your strategy. Utilizing analytics tools to monitor keyword rankings, website traffic, and user behavior provides a comprehensive understanding of your SEO landscape.

    As you delve into how to do SEO for a website step by step, adapting your strategy based on performance data becomes a crucial component. Analyzing successful tactics and identifying areas for improvement ensures that your SEO efforts align with the ever-evolving algorithms of search engines. Consistent tracking not only provides valuable insights into the effectiveness of your approach but also allows you to refine and optimize your strategy for sustained success.

    Keywords are not just static elements within your content; they are dynamic entities that evolve based on user trends and search engine algorithms. The strategic inclusion of your keyword within your content and overall SEO strategy is not just a one-time task; it’s an ongoing effort that requires continuous monitoring and adaptation.

    Furthermore, the insights gained from tracking your progress extend beyond just SEO. Understanding user behavior, popular search queries, and the performance of different pieces of content provides a holistic view of your website’s digital footprint. The keyword, strategically placed within this analytical landscape, becomes more than just a tag; it becomes a reference point for understanding the preferences and expectations of your audience.

    Consistency in tracking your progress, combined with the strategic integration of your keyword, positions your website as not just a digital entity but a dynamic and responsive presence in the online ecosystem. It’s not just about monitoring numbers; it’s about gaining insights that fuel the continuous enhancement of your content and overall online strategy.

    Moreover, the adaptability gained from consistent tracking extends to various aspects of your digital presence. Whether it’s adjusting content strategies, optimizing technical elements, or refining outreach efforts for backlinks, the keyword serves as a guiding reference point. It becomes more than just a part of your SEO strategy; it becomes a compass that directs your efforts towards areas that contribute most significantly to your website’s success.

    Bonus Tips

    Incorporating images and videos into your content enhances engagement by breaking up text and providing visual appeal. This not only captures the audience’s attention but also makes the information more digestible and enjoyable.

    Promoting your website on social media and other channels expands its reach beyond search engines. Sharing your content on platforms like Facebook, Twitter, or Instagram increases visibility and encourages user interaction.

    Patience is key in SEO; results take time. Consistent effort in creating quality content and optimizing your site will yield long-term success.

    Remember, SEO is an ongoing process. Continuously create valuable content, optimize your site, and stay updated on industry trends for sustained success.

    In conclusion, how to do SEO for a website step by step involves a comprehensive and strategic approach. From understanding your audience to consistently tracking your progress, each element contributes to the overall success of your SEO strategy. The keyword, strategically placed throughout this journey, becomes more than just a tag; it becomes a unifying element that aligns your content, structure, and outreach efforts with the preferences and expectations of your audience in the ever-evolving digital landscape.